I would like to replace the current HDD, please help me to choose the right SSD model for my HP Pavilion Desktop PC 570-p0xx product number 1JV54EA#ABZ.
Which type should I choose?
1) M.2 SATA
2) M.2 PCIe
3) M.2 PCIe NVMe
thank you in advance

You have an HP PAVILION DESKTOP - 570-P013NL.
The M.2 PCIe NVMe (having socket Key M) is the correct choice.
Because the current hard drive is 1TB, you need to consider the "used" GB on the drive.
How do you plan to convert to the MVMe ? There several scenerio's. Have you thought it out ?
